Milan
Milan, the capital of Lombardy, is Italy's second-largest city, home to over 1.3 million people. Located on the northwestern edge of the Po Valley, between the Ticino and Adda rivers, it serves as a hub for fashion and finance. The Teatro alla Scala, one of the world's most renowned opera houses, attracts culture enthusiasts. Milan is also home to many universities and cultural institutions. Spring and autumn are the ideal seasons to visit, with mild temperatures perfect for exploring.
